小程序定制开发校园是一个涉及多个方面的复杂项目,需要综合考虑用户需求、技术实现、安全性和用户体验等因素。以下是一些步骤和建议,用于指导如何进行小程序定制开发校园:
1. 需求分析与规划:
(1) 与学校管理层、教师、学生和家长进行沟通,了解他们对小程序的期望和需求。
(2) 确定小程序的主要功能,如课程表查询、成绩查询、校园新闻、活动信息发布等。
(3) 制定详细的开发计划,包括时间表、预算、资源分配等。
2. 设计阶段:
(1) 设计用户界面(ui),确保界面简洁、易用且符合学校的品牌形象。
(2) 设计用户体验(ux),确保用户能够轻松地找到他们需要的功能,并在使用过程中感到舒适。
(3) 考虑移动端和桌面端的兼容性,确保小程序在不同设备上都能良好运行。
3. 技术选型:
(1) 根据需求选择合适的开发框架和技术栈,如微信小程序原生开发、云开发等。
(2) 考虑使用第三方服务或api来简化开发过程,如地图服务、支付接口等。
4. 开发与测试:
(1) 按照设计文档进行编码,确保代码质量高、可维护性强。
(2) 进行单元测试、集成测试和系统测试,确保小程序的稳定性和性能。
(3) 邀请用户参与测试,收集反馈并进行迭代优化。
5. 上线与推广:
(1) 在微信公众平台申请小程序账号,提交审核。
(2) 完成所有必要的认证和设置,确保小程序能够正常运营。
(3) 通过各种渠道推广小程序,如社交媒体、学校官网等。
6. 维护与更新:
(1) 定期收集用户反馈,对小程序进行维护和更新。
(2) 根据学校的发展需求和技术进步,不断优化小程序的功能和体验。
7. 安全与合规性:
(1) 确保小程序符合相关的法律法规和标准,保护用户的隐私和数据安全。
(2) 定期检查和更新小程序的安全设置,防止潜在的安全风险。
8. 持续合作与支持:
(1) 与学校保持紧密的合作关系,及时了解学校的最新动态和需求变化。
(2) 提供持续的技术支持和培训,帮助用户更好地使用小程序。
总之,小程序定制开发校园是一个需要多方面考虑和精心策划的项目。通过明确的需求分析、合理的设计规划、合适的技术选型、严格的开发测试流程以及有效的推广和维护策略,可以确保小程序能够满足学校的需求,提高用户体验,促进校园信息化建设。